工学

问答题什么叫中断?什么叫中断源?有哪些中断源?

题目
问答题
什么叫中断?什么叫中断源?有哪些中断源?
如果没有搜索结果,请直接 联系老师 获取答案。
如果没有搜索结果,请直接 联系老师 获取答案。
相似问题和答案

第1题:

什么是中断?常见的中断源有哪几类?CPU响应中断的条件是什么?


正确答案: 中断是指CPU在正常执行程序时,由于内部/外部时间或程序的预先安排引起CPU暂时终止执行现行程序,转而去执行请求CPU为其服务的服务程序,待该服务程序执行完毕,又能自动返回到被中断的程序继续执行的过程。
常见的中断源有:一般的输入/输出设备请求中断;实时时钟请求中断;故障源;数据通道中断和软件中断。
CPU响应中断的条件:若为非屏蔽中断请求,则CPU执行完现行指令后,就立即响应中断。CPU若要响应可屏蔽中断请求,必须满足以下三个条件:
①无总线请求;
②CPU允许中断;
③CPU执行完现行指令。

第2题:

什么叫中断?什么叫中断源?有哪些中断源?


正确答案: 中断就是使CPU暂停运行原来的程序而应更为急迫事件的需要转向去执行为中断源服务的程序(称为中断服务程序),待该程序处理完后,再返回运行原程序。
所谓中断源,即引起中断的事件或原因,或发出中断申请的来源。
通常中断源有以下4种:外部设备;实时时钟;故障源;为调试程序设置的中断源。

第3题:

什么叫中断铁路行车?中断行车的时间怎样计算?


正确答案: 中断铁路行车系指不论事故发生在区间或站内,造成铁路单线、双线区间或双线区间之一线不能行车。
中断行车的时间,由事故发生时间起(列车火灾或爆炸由停车时间算起)至恢复客货列车原牵引方式连续通行时止。
如列车能在站内其他线通行,又回到原正线上进入区间的,不按中断行车算。
施工封锁区间发生冲突或脱轨的行车中断时间,从事故发生前原计划开通的时间起计算。

第4题:

什么是中断源?中断分为几类?


正确答案:中断可分为内中断和外中断。
内中断是由计算机内部原因引起的中断,内中断又称为软中断,它通常由三种情况引起:
(1)由中断指令INT引起:
(2)由于CPU的某些错误而引起,如溢出中断、除法错中断等:
(3)为调试程序(DEBUG)设置的中断,如单步中断、断点中断。
外中断指由外部事件引起的中断,又称为硬中断。硬件中断主要有两种来源:
(1)非屏蔽中断(NMl),如电源故障中断、实时钟中断等:
(2)可屏蔽中断,一般是由于各种外部设备请求CPU提供服务所引起的中断。

第5题:

什么叫中断?什么叫可屏蔽中断和不可屏蔽中断?


正确答案:当CPU正常运行程序时,由于微处理器内部事件或外设请求,引起CPU 中断正在运行的程序,转去执行请求中断的外设(或内部事件)的中断服务子程序,中断服务程序执行完毕, 再返回被中止的程序,这一过程称为中断。
可屏蔽中断由引脚INTR引入,采用电平触发,高电平有效,INTR信号的高电平必须 维持到CPU 响应中断才结束。可以通过软件设置来屏蔽外部中断,即使外部设备有中断请 求,CPU可以不予响应。当外设有中断申请时,在当前指令执行完后,CPU首先查询IF位,若IF=0,CPU就禁止响应任何外设中断;若IF=1,CPU就允许响应外设的中断请求。 不可屏蔽中断由引脚NMI引入,边沿触发,上升沿之后维持两个时钟周期高电平有效。不能用软件来屏蔽的,一旦有不可屏蔽中断请求,如电源掉电等紧急情况,CPU必须予以响应。

第6题:

8088/8086CPU管理有哪些中断源?各种中断的产生条件是什么?


正确答案:NMI中断和INTR中断。INTR中断产生的条件是:无总线请求、FR.IF=1、CPU执行完当前指令。

第7题:

什么叫中断向量?


正确答案: 中断向量就是一个包含每个中断处理程序开始地址的表格.

第8题:

什么是中断源?一片8059可以扩展几个中断源?


正确答案: 把引起中断的原因或触发中断请求的来源称为中断源。8259共有8个中断源。

第9题:

什么叫做中断源?中断源有哪些? 


正确答案: 引起中断的原因,或能发出中断申请的来源称为中断源。
中断源有:输入输出设备、数据通道中断源、实时时钟、故障源、为调试程序而设的中断源。

第10题:

什么是中断类型码?什么叫中断向量?什么叫中断向量表?它们之间有什么联系?


正确答案: 8086/8088系统可以处理256种中断,为了区别每一种中断,为每个中断安排一个号码,称为中断类型码。每一种中断服务程序在内存中的起始地址称为中断向量,以32位逻辑地址表示,即为CS:IP。把所有中断向量存储在内存中的某一个连续区中,这个连续的存储区称为中断向量表。
中断向量表中偏移量为(中断类型码×4)的单元中存放IP的值,偏移量为(中断类型码×4+2)的单元中存放CS的值。